Transaction 39e8028747a8541ebdc210dd7b3425b0e2a6ffe96a7af6bc4b9c094d82475730
1 Input
1 Output
-
39e8028747a8541ebdc210dd7b3425b0e2a6ffe96a7af6bc4b9c094d82475730:0
- value
- 2394355
- script pubkey
- OP_0 OP_PUSHBYTES_20 895f60187c78580c0c0ca77cf919db60585e54cf
- address
- bc1q390kqxru0pvqcrqv5a70jxwmvpv9u4x00t2n6w